Output c27611ceb3b706d85716b29a17840bd6c243c77db7a7e6f7ddf517d83ce63b6d:84

value
133590
script pubkey
OP_0 OP_PUSHBYTES_20 ec43312a243d2a13f7033a8007fde0f38cc3043f
address
bc1qa3pnz23y854p8acr82qq0l0q7wxvxpplne98lq
transaction
c27611ceb3b706d85716b29a17840bd6c243c77db7a7e6f7ddf517d83ce63b6d
spent
true